Formation and reactivity of cobalt(III)-dioxygen complexes promoted by 2-methylpropanal: Oxidation of alkenes and alcohols

Abstract:2-Methylpropanal promotes the formation of cobalt(III)-dioxygen species from catalysts1 or2 and dioxygen. The cobalt(III)-dioxygen complexes efficiently catalyse the oxidation of various alcohols to carbonyl compounds in the presence of dioxygen and 2-methylpropanal. Similarly substituted alkenes are smoothly transformed to the corresponding monoepoxides under these reaction conditions. EPR study of these reactions indicates that different activated dioxygen species are formed in the presence of catalysts1 and2.
